I'm thinking of going on a day trip (or 1 night) to France before the weather gets too cold...just so I can say I have been abroad on the bike
Can I go there on a 33hp licence? And if my insurance provides European cover, can I literally just ride to Dover and get on a boat (or Folkstone, and get on a train) or do I have to sign any forms or make any phone calls?

Just go, you will have insurance cover but best check policy just in case.
no forms other than filling in stuff to book.
need gb badge, all your bike docs, reflective stickers on helmet, Passport. GO
I prefer tunnel. book online. it'll cost about £27 for a 2 day return. Be carefull of the "priority to the right" in the towns and especially out in the country. I've been here 10 years and it still catches me out now and then.
When you enter a village or town, there will always be a sign with the name of it on it, that's when the 50kph starts, and finishes on the sign on the exit of said village / town.
